The Problems Homeowners Face with Driveway Installation

Homeowners often encounter several challenges when installing or replacing a driveway. Uneven surfaces, poor drainage, and cracking are common issues that can arise without proper planning and execution. A poorly installed driveway not only diminishes your home's appearance but can also lead to costly repairs.

Quality matters. Without the right Concrete Driveway Installation Processes, including proper site preparation, driveways can suffer from premature wear due to a weak foundation. Site preparation is essential because it ensures the ground is excavated, graded, and compacted to create a stable base. Without these steps, issues like sinking or water pooling can occur, compromising the driveway's durability and weather resistance.

Why Concrete Driveway Is the Perfect Solution

Concrete Driveways combine durability, functionality, and visual appeal, making them the go-to choice for homeowners seeking a long-lasting solution. Our process begins with meticulous site preparation. This includes excavation to remove any existing debris, grading to ensure proper water drainage, and compacting the soil to create a level, stable foundation. These steps are non-negotiable for achieving a driveway that stands the test of time.

Once the foundation is ready, the concrete is carefully poured and shaped to match your desired design. Texturing is then applied to provide slip resistance while enhancing the aesthetic appeal. Curing is a critical step that allows the concrete to harden properly, ensuring maximum strength and durability.

How It Works: Concrete Driveway Installation in 5 Steps

  1. Initial Consultation: We assess your site and discuss your design preferences and needs.
  2. Site Preparation: Excavation, grading, and compaction create a strong foundation for your driveway.
  3. Concrete Pouring: We carefully mix and pour the concrete to ensure even coverage and strength.
  4. Texturing and Curing: The surface is textured for safety and aesthetics, then cured for lasting durability.
  5. Sealing and Finishing: A protective sealant is applied, ensuring your driveway is weather-resistant and polished.
